Job description

Proactive Outreach: Initiate contact with prospects, proactively engage in conversation to uncover user needs and pain points, and identify opportunities for providing assistance and value during the trial phase. Sales Partnership: Collaborate with the sales team to provide the necessary information and assist in the pursuit and closure of deals requiring a more robust commercial process or technical expertise. Deal Closure: Utilize consultative sales tactics to close deals, understand and address customer needs and preferences, and navigate the sales process efficiently to meet individual and team goals. Enablement Call Preparation: Prepare for enablement calls to craft a personalized customer journey, use gathered information to create a tailored plan for the user’s needs, develop a comprehensive understanding of how the product/service addresses the user’s challenges, and optimize the trial experience for product adoption and conversion. Discovery Process: Conduct a thorough discovery process to understand the prospect’s requirements, uncover key pain points and challenges faced by the user, and gather insights to tailor solutions and recommendations effectively. Fluent in English, and Portuguese speaking, reading comprehension, and writing skills required. Spanish is a nice-to-have. 1-3 years of hands-on experience in a customer-facing role (Sales/Success experience preferred, as the role involves managing a pipeline and multiple inbound channels). A commitment to achieving results and a history of taking initiative to drive success. A proven ability to address challenges, objections, and obstacles. Strong written and verbal communication skills. Experience using technology and software tools, as the role involves showcasing the product and using internal systems. An understanding and experience in adopting a customer-centric mindset, focusing on customer needs and providing tailored solutions. The ability to adapt to evolving commercial strategies, changing market conditions, and dynamic/varied prospect needs. Familiarity with the SaaS/Martech industry, including an understanding of key trends and knowledge of the competitive landscape. Experience using Customer Relationship Management (CRM) systems and other sales automation tools. Strong time management skills. A willingness to continuously learn and stay updated on industry trends, commercial methodologies, and product knowledge. A Bachelor’s degree in a relevant field (Business, Marketing, Communications) is preferred, but not required.
